A vulnerability in the Linux kernel's netfs subsystem was resolved by fixing netfs_invalidate_folio() to clear the dirty bit when all changes to a folio are removed. Without this fix, truncating a file after a streaming write could leave a folio marked dirty without the associated netfs_folio struct, causing a kernel oops when the folio is read via mmap(). This issue could be reproduced under specific conditions involving streaming writes, truncation, and memory mapping. The fix involves calling folio_cancel_dirty() to clear the dirty flag appropriately.
